New York -  U.S. Senator Chuck Schumer says he wants his colleagues to vote on gun control legislation by the end of April.  

He held a rally in Manhattan on Sunday and called on Senate Majority Leader Mitch McConnell to allow a vote on legislation.  Schumer says Republicans are dragging their feet on gun control.  The bills he's pushing include tougher background checks and an assault weapons ban.  

Schumer says he's optimistic that bills addressing gun violence will be passed in the coming weeks.
